Holding

The suit is struck out as it is statutory time barred.

Facts

The Plaintiff claims ownership of a plot of land known as PLOT No. 13 'A' NCHIRU MARKET, which is registered in the name of deceased ALDO MBAYA. The Plaintiff alleges a contract of sale in January 2009.

Issues

  1. Ownership of the land
  2. Statute of limitations

Reasoning

The Plaintiff's claim is contract-based and filed outside the six-year limitation period under Section 4 of the Limitation of Actions Act. The land is registered in the name of a deceased person, and the Plaintiff has not established that the land belongs to the deceased.

Outcome

The suit is struck out.

Orders

  • The suit is struck out as it is statutory time barred.

Remedies

  • Plaintiff is condemned to pay costs of the suit.
